Title: Comparing Two Methods of Topical Anesthesia for Fiberoptic Bronchoscopy
Purpose: To compare the effectiveness of two methods of anesthesia, pre-procedure lignocaine spray (PPL) and spray-as-you-go (SAYG), in reducing discomfort and improving operator comfort during fiberoptic bronchoscopy.
Study Design: Randomized controlled trial Participants: 50 patients undergoing fiberoptic bronchoscopy Interventions: Patients received either PPL or SAYG anesthesia
Outcomes:
* Pain perception * Cough severity * Operator comfort * Procedure duration
Results:
* Both PPL and SAYG methods were effective in reducing pain and discomfort * No significant differences were observed between the two groups in pain perception, cough scores, or procedure duration * Operator comfort scores showed a trend favoring PPL, but the difference was not statistically significant
Implications: Both PPL and SAYG methods can be effectively used for fiberoptic bronchoscopy, with potential implications for procedural efficiency and patient outcomes.

A single-blind RCT included 50 participants were randomly assigned to two groups (n = 25 each). Standard procedural sedation with midazolam and 2 mL of 4% lignocaine spray in the oropharynx was used to suppress the gag reflex. Additionally, 2% lignocaine spray was administered during the procedure according to body weight (3 mg/kg) via oral scope insertion. Cough severity, pain perception, and operator comfort were assessed using the Visual Analogue Scale, Faces Pain Rating Scale, and a 4-point Likert scale, respectively.

Cough severity measured using 100-mm Visual Analog Scale where 0 mm = no cough and 100 mm = worst cough imaginable. Higher scores indicate worse cough severity.
Time frame: One year
Pain intensity measured using Faces Pain Rating Scale (0-10) where 0 = no pain and 10 = worst pain possible. Higher scores indicate worse pain.
Time frame: One year
Operator comfort assessed via 4-point Likert scale where 1 = Not comfortable, 2 = Slightly uncomfortable, 3 = Comfortable, and 4 = Very comfortable. Higher scores indicate better comfort.
Time frame: One year
Comparison of procedure duration between PPL and SAYG airway anesthesia methods, measured in minutes from scope insertion to withdrawal.
